Linux kernel team publishes 432 CVEs in two days
The Linux kernel security team published 432 CVEs across a single weekend (Sunday and Monday), overwhelming sysadmins and security professionals who must decide how to prioritise and patch them. The sudden surge has prompted concern that traditional, individualised vulnerability triage is no longer feasible, with some experts speculating that AI-assisted bug hunting is behind the flood of reports, echoing warnings Linux creator Linus Torvalds made in May about the kernel security mailing list becoming unmanageable.
Jan Schaumann, chief information security architect at Akamai, raised the alarm on the OSS-SEC mailing list, arguing it is no longer practical to prioritise individual kernel changes and that even using an LLM to triage the backlog wouldn't meaningfully help. He suggested automated, frequent fleet-wide updates as the only realistic approach, though he acknowledged this is difficult for large organisations with lengthy QA cycles and long-term support commitments. Kernel maintainer Greg Kroah-Hartman has previously noted that the kernel team assigns a CVE to any bugfix that could affect a system's confidentiality, integrity or availability, meaning many entries in this batch are minor in scope but still technically qualify as vulnerabilities.
